The Serie B tie at Stadio Giuseppe Moccagatta on Monday sees home team Alessandria play visiting opponents Reggina, and our team has the latest predicted line ups and news on player availability.
Alessandria will be hoping for a repeat of their last result, following a 1-2 Serie B success versus Cittadella. It seems likely that L'Orso could use the 3-4-3 formation for the game featuring Matteo Pisseri, Edoardo Pierozzi, Valerio Mantovani, Giuseppe Prestia, Gabriel Lunetta, Abou Ba, Luca Parodi, Tommaso Milanese, Simone Palombi, Michele Marconi and Simone Corazza.
Francesco Orlando, Gabriele Bellodi and Andrea Palazzi will not be able to play for Alessandria manager Moreno Longo.

Reggina will go into this clash after a 1-0 Serie B win to beat Lecce in their most recent outing. It’s our belief that Gli Amaranto seem likely to play in a 3-5-2 lineup, giving starts to Stefano Turati, Giuseppe Loiacono, D. Stavropoulos, Thiago Rangel Cionek, Cristiano Lombardi, A. Cortinovis, Lorenzo Crisetig, Tomasz Kupisz, Gianluca Di Chiara, Adriano Montalto and M. I. Folorunsho.
From a largely available group of players, there’s only the sole fitness problem for the Reggina gaffer Roberto Stellone to contend with. Ivan Lakicevic (Unknown Injury) won’t be playing here.
